What is the refractive status of a newborn?

A
Myopic
B
Hypermetropic
C
Astigmatic
D
Emmetropic
High-Yield Explanation
(b) HypermetropicRef: Khurana 6/e, p. 13Eye at birthNewborn is Hypermetropic by +2 to +3 D Anteroposterior diameter is smaller (70% of adult) - 16.5 mm Corneal horizontal diameter is smaller - 9.5 to 10 mm Tears are not secreted AC is shallow
